课程介绍
本课程主要结合Python win32com包介绍WPS表格(Excel)数据处理的各种方法。相关内容包括Python语言基础、WPS表格对象模型、公式和l函数、图形、图表、数据透视表、字典应用、正则表达式等。使用win32com包,VBA能做的Python也能做。
点这里看视频课程
课程目录
第一章:Python语法基础
概述-Python语言及其应用和特点 06:59
概述-下载安装Python IDLE 10:59
概述-编程示例 20:13
概述-编程规范 15:44
常量和变量-常量 09:41
常量和变量-变量-变量命名 04:24
常量和变量-变量-变量的声明、赋值和删除 05:00
常量和变量-变量-变量的数据类型 06:42
常量和变量-数字-整型数字 05:14
常量和变量-数字-浮点型数字 05:10
常量和变量-数字-复数 02:38
常量和变量-数字-类型转换 05:02
表达式-算术运算符 08:32
表达式-关系运算符 02:58
表达式-逻辑运算符 07:07
表达式-赋值/算术赋值/成员/身份运算符 07:59
表达式-运算符的优先级 07:52
流程控制-判断结构-单分支判断结构 06:36
流程控制-判断结构-二分支判断结构 03:00
流程控制-判断结构-多分支判断结构 04:33
流程控制-判断结构-有嵌套的判断结构 04:26
流程控制-判断结构-三元操作表达式 05:16
流程控制-循环结构-for循环 05:48
流程控制-循环结构-嵌套for循环 05:30
流程控制-循环结构-for…else用法 06:08
流程控制-循环结构-简单while循环 05:55
流程控制-循环结构-有分支的while循环 02:40
流程控制-循环结构-while循环嵌套 04:18
流程控制-其他结构 07:31
字符串-创建字符串 11:39
字符串-索引和切片 13:02
字符串-字符串的格式化输出 15:57
字符串-字符串的大小写 02:12
字符串-字符串的分割和连接 06:30
字符串-字符串的查找和替换 06:22
字符串-字符串的比较 08:37
字符串-去除字符串两端的空格 02:17
日期时间-获取日期和时间 04:58
日期时间-格式化日期和时间 07:34
列表-创建列表 13:02
列表-索引和切片 06:47
列表-添加和插入列表元素 05:10
列表-删除列表元素 03:34
列表-列表元素排序 02:46
列表-列表元素计算 03:17
列表-列表的过滤 03:01
列表-二维列表 05:08
元组-元组的创建和删除 07:31
元组-索引和切片 04:34
元组-基本运算和操作 03:36
字典-字典的创建 15:46
字典-索引 05:39
字典-字典元素的增删改 06:12
字典-字典数据的格式化输出 07:17
集合-集合的创建 08:02
集合-集合元素的添加和删除 02:04
集合-集合的运算 13:04
函数-内部函数 08:25
函数-标准模块函数 11:57
函数-自定义函数-函数定义和调用 13:15
函数-自定义函数-有多个返回值的情况 06:27
函数-自定义函数-默认参数和可选参数 04:10
函数-自定义函数-可变参数 05:14
函数-自定义函数-参数为字典 03:54
函数-自定义函数-传值还是传址 12:23
函数-变量的作用范围 04:56
函数-匿名函数 03:18
模块-内置和第三方模块 05:24
模块-自定义模块 10:56
工程-导入内置模块和第三方模块 07:25
工程-导入自定义模块 04:50
异常处理-常见异常 03:19
异常处理-异常捕获-单分支的情况 03:25
异常处理-异常捕获-多分支的情况 06:13
异常处理-异常捕获-try…except…else… 02:14
异常处理-异常捕获-try…finally… 02:19
第二章:Python win32com包和WPS表格对象模型
win32com包及其安装 07:32
使用win32com包的一般过程 09:37
面向对象编程的相关概念 10:43
WPS表格对象及其层次结构 08:22
第三章:单元格对象
引用单元格 21:00
引用整行和整列 22:32
引用单元格区域 10:55
引用所有单元格/特殊区域/区域的集合 15:05
扩展引用当前工作表中的单元格区域 08:35
引用末行或末列 09:45
引用特殊的单元格 08:01
区域的行数/列数/左上角/右下角/形状/大小 05:23
插入单元格或区域 09:04
单元格(区域)的选择和清除 07:33
单元格的复制/粘贴/剪切和删除 21:34
单元格的名称、批注和字体设置 17:48
单元格的对齐方式、背景色和边框 12:22
第四章:工作表对象
相关对象 08:00
创建和引用工作表 12:51
激活、复制、移动和删除工作表 16:07
隐藏和显示工作表 05:35
选择行和列 09:44
复制/剪切行和列 07:33
插入行和列 08:53
删除行和列 14:12
设置行高和列宽 06:55
第五章:工作簿对象
创建和打开工作簿 10:27
引用、激活、保存和关闭工作簿 12:30
第六章:WPS表格应用对象
位置、大小、标题、可见性和状态属性 07:50
其他常用属性 13:18
第七章:数据读写
读取WPS表格数据到Python列表 08:29
将Python列表数据写入WPS表格工作表 06:58
第八章:图表
WPS表格图表概述 08:46
创建图表-创建图表工作表 12:02
创建图表-创建嵌入式图表 10:03
创建图表-用Shapes对象创建图表 06:00
创建图表-绑定数据 05:30
图表及其序列-设置图表的类型 06:35
图表及其序列-Chart对象的常用属性和方法 04:55
图表及其序列-设置序列中单个点的属性 10:45
基本图形元素-颜色设置 04:59
基本图形元素-线形图元的属性设置 15:12
基本图形元素-区域的透明度和单色渐变填充 07:24
基本图形元素-区域的双色渐变和图案填充 09:57
基本图形元素-区域的双色渐变和图案填充 07:54
基本图形元素-区域的图片和纹理填充 10:13
坐标系-Axes对象和Axis对象 05:28
坐标系-坐标轴 07:03
坐标系-坐标轴标题 05:32
坐标系-数值轴取值范围 02:53
坐标系-刻度线 09:20
坐标系-刻度标签 08:11
坐标系-网格线 10:24
坐标系-多轴图 10:37
坐标系-对数坐标图 04:07
坐标系-其他属性 07:30
图表元素-SetElement方法 06:40
图表元素-图表区域/绘图区 08:08
图表元素-图例 06:10
输出图表-将图表复制到剪贴板 06:15
输出图表-图表保存为图片 03:51
第九章:数据透视表
WPS表格数据透视表概述 06:12
创建-用PivotTableWizard方法创建透视表 17:48
创建-用缓存创建数据透视表 11:06
创建-数据透视表的引用 07:20
创建-刷新数据透视表 05:37
编辑-添加字段 07:32
编辑-修改字段 04:43
编辑-设置字段的数字格式 05:04
编辑-数据透视表的单元格区域属性设置 13:14
布局和样式-设置布局方式 06:05
布局和样式-设置样式 03:50
布局和样式-设置总计行和总计列的显示方式 05:28
排序和筛选-排序 06:05
排序和筛选-筛选 09:23
计算-设置字段的汇总方式 07:23
计算-设置数据显示方式 06:17
第十章:公式和函数
概述-函数 11:32
概述-公式 22:41
概述-公式中单元格的引用 14:42
添加公式-输入普通公式 09:13
添加公式-用Formula属性输入A1样式的公式 02:30
添加公式-用FormulaR1C1属性输入R1C1样式的公式 03:12
添加公式-用FormulaArray属性输入数组公式 04:27
添加公式-使用WorksheetFunction属性 06:27
添加公式-使用Evaluate方法 06:02
公式相关-在单元格区域中查找公式 08:11
公式相关-判断指定单元格区域是否有公式 04:54
公式相关-复制和粘贴公式 08:08
公式相关-自动/手动计算 08:27
公式相关-自动填充公式 07:06
公式相关-隐藏和取消隐藏公式 03:38
名称用于公式-名称 03:43
名称用于公式-创建名称 06:58
名称用于公式-引用定义的名称创建公式 04:10
名称用于公式-把公式指定为名称 03:57
第十一章:正则表达式
概述-什么是正则表达式 09:53
概述-正则表达式示例 14:00
Python使用正则表达式-re模块-查找 14:03
Python使用正则表达式-re模块-替换 04:16
Python使用正则表达式-re模块-分割 04:26
Python使用正则表达式-Match对象 12:45
Python使用正则表达式-Pattern对象 06:17
编写正则表达式-元字符 12:50
编写正则表达式-重复 10:56
编写正则表达式-字符类 12:04
编写正则表达式-分支条件 04:20
编写正则表达式-捕获分组和非捕获分组 21:14
编写正则表达式-零宽断言 07:59
编写正则表达式-负向零宽断言 06:28
编写正则表达式-贪婪与懒惰 05:27
示例-提取字符串 09:53
示例-计算各班总人数 06:33
示例-提取日期 04:59
示例-整理数据 09:31
示例-提取数据 09:01
示例-整理数据 08:18
示例-数据汇总 05:56